Anti-tumor effect of the truncated peptides from NDRG2 on U87MG and U251 cells

2014 
Objective The anti-tumor effect of the truncated peptides derived from N-myc down stream regalated gene 2(NDRG2) on U87MG and U251 cells is observed. Methods The hNDRG2 protein truncated into several parts and their eukaryotic expression plasmids were constructed respectively. The two glioma cell lines(U87MG,U251) were transfected by the eukaryotic expression plasmids and their cell cycle arrest and apoptosis were detected by flow cytometry(FCM). Results The results of flow cytometry showed all the segments which contained the C-terminal of NDRG2 could lead to cell cycle arrest in different degrees extending to all two cell lines. Conclusion C-terminal of NDRG2 plays the most important role in its anti-tumor effect. It is of high probability to find anti-tumor peptides from NDRG2.
